Photographer’s Note
My grandfather (we always called him "Pa") was a farmer all of his life. He also was very good at carpentry. He built this boathouse on a pond behind his house. For years he kept a small, aluminum, flatbottom boat stored in here. He also built two small wooden boats that we have hanging in an old barn behind his house.
Post-processing: I converted the original to sepia. Small amount of "clarify" filter; USM, and added the frame.
